It is important that you familiarize yourself with your states regulations regarding homeschooling. While some states require a parent to be a participant in standardized testing, others make parents go through standardized testing. Some states even make parents to register as a school.

Try using a unit study method for teaching your children. Unit methods have you study means that you only study a single topic at once. This gives you the topic. One example of this is a course in classical music for six weeks. After the six weeks is completed, attend a classical music performance. This will really help your child understand how the things they just learned into their daily life.
